Neighborhood Overview

Shnapek Tennis is situated in a central West Oakland neighborhood, offering convenient access to major thoroughfares like I-880 and I-980. The facility is well-integrated into the local street grid, making it accessible for those driving from around the Bay Area. While street parking is the primary option nearby, visitors should be mindful of local signage and residential permit zones. The venue is approximately 12 miles from Oakland International Airport (OAK), which typically takes 20 to 30 minutes by car depending on traffic conditions.

Navigating the area is best done by car, though the neighborhood is served by local transit lines that connect to the broader BART network. Rideshare services are highly effective for those looking to avoid parking concerns, with quick pickup and drop-off times throughout the day. When arriving, we recommend planning for a few extra minutes to find street parking if the courts are busy. Following these simple logistics will help your team focus entirely on their warm-ups and match preparations without the stress of navigating complex urban transit.

The surrounding area has a mix of residential and industrial character, which provides a quiet atmosphere conducive to focused play. Visitors will find that the proximity to downtown Oakland means that additional services are just a short drive away if needed. Smart arrival tactics include checking the local schedule for any neighborhood events that might impact street availability during peak hours. Overall, the location balances accessibility with a neighborhood feel that is perfect for athletic gatherings.

Weather & Seasons

❄️

Winter

Winter in Oakland is mild, with temperatures typically ranging in the 50s and 60s. While it is rarely freezing, you should pack a light jacket or layers for the cool mornings and evenings. Rain is more frequent during these months, so be prepared for potential court closures.

🌱

Spring & early summer

This is a beautiful time to visit, with comfortable temperatures and plenty of sunshine. You will want to wear breathable athletic gear during the day, but a light sweater is still useful for the evenings. The conditions are generally ideal for consistent outdoor tennis play.

☀️

Mid-summer

Expect warm, clear days with temperatures often reaching the 70s or low 80s. High-quality sunscreen and plenty of water are essential for staying safe on the courts. The dry heat makes for excellent playing conditions, provided you manage your hydration throughout the match.

🍂

Fall season

Fall is arguably the best time for sports in the Bay Area, featuring crisp air and beautiful golden light. Temperatures remain very comfortable, allowing for long days of activity without excessive heat. It is a great season for visiting teams to enjoy the outdoors.

📅

Rain & snow

Rain is possible during the cooler months, which can impact scheduling for outdoor tennis. Snow is virtually non-existent in Oakland, so you never need to worry about winter road closures. Always have a backup indoor activity planned if the weather forecast looks uncertain.
